Explorer and presidential guide owned this house
by BlockShopper Historian published Feb. 01, 2010
Explorer Anthony Fiala owned this house in 1938. He was in command of the Ziegler Polar Expedition from 1903 to 1905. In 1914 Fiala accompanied President Theodore Roosevelt on an expedition into the unexplored wilds of Brazil. He passed away in 1950.
